Output 904864526ebd3b699191e8a3f856b3cb122b7115ea8cdc9d05949d4b83c847e6:0

value
25430740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 355029f58b45369e411f3a970485805fdd3afda1 OP_EQUAL
address
36YumbYWVwFzshvPxhx2txy6sPyHHnzE1C
transaction
904864526ebd3b699191e8a3f856b3cb122b7115ea8cdc9d05949d4b83c847e6
spent
true